Sources inside North Carolina’s Republican establishment tell NOTUS they’ve all but given up on MAGA psychopath Lt Gov Mark Robinson’s gubernatorial bid over weak polling numbers and a constant stream of bad press about his degenerate ways. “For Robinson to win, he will need to be on offense for a consistent period or for Trump to considerably overperform his 2016 margin,” said Republican strategist Doug Heye, who long warned that Robinson would be toxic in a general election. “Not impossible, but neither of those seem likely,” Heye continued, with his assessment of the race against Dem Attorney General Josh Stein, who holds a massive cash advantage.
“I said this would happen over and over again, and so I don’t know why it’s a surprise to people. He can’t moderate his positions now because, at this point, the average voter has a decidedly set opinion about him. And the hits keep coming,” said 2024 GOP gov primary loser Bill Graham.
“As far as for swing voters, there was little to no definition for Mark Robinson coming out of the primary, and the Josh Stein campaign has done a very effective job of defining him to that universal swing voter first,” said Republican strategist Paul Shumaker, who backed Graham’s bid.
Robinson himself seemed to acknowledge the predicament two weeks ago, saying “if nothing changes on the fundraising front, not only do we risk losing this race, but the White House too,” in an acknowledgement that the mythical “reverse coattails” effect could come true in the Tar Heel state.
